I. The Impact of AIGC Applications on K12 Education
The educational landscape is undergoing a transformation thanks to the integration of AI and advanced technologies within K12 education. Policies promoting reduced homework burdens have prompted educational enterprises to redefine their strategies. With the focus shifting towards using off-campus tutoring as a supplement rather than a primary source of education, technological advancements have taken center stage.
The launch of ChatGPT and similar AI tools has been revolutionary, marking a new epoch in educational reform. The Ministry of Education announced plans to implement AI solutions broadly within classrooms, encouraging large models that enhance both classroom interactions and off-campus scenarios.
In this context, educational companies are leveraging AI models to improve quality, personalize learning experiences, and develop innovative instructional methods. Major corporations in the field have embraced these technologies, incorporating them into their platforms and achieving competitive advantages.

III. Key Functional Innovations Driven by Large Models
The functional innovations introduced by large models in educational applications are extensive. Functions like AI Error Books, Intelligent Question Generation, and advanced learning analysis tools have emerged as critical elements in modernizing educational experiences for students and teachers alike.
1. **AI Error Book**: This feature provides valuable insights into student mistakes, personalizing the feedback to enhance learning and retention rates.
2. **Intelligent Question Generation**: This innovative solution helps create an engaging curriculum, reflecting various students' learning patterns.
3. **Learning Situation Analysis**: This function interprets students' progress, providing real-time insights and recommendations for tailored learning experiences.
